preceding workers on Golden Age manuscript The Orphan’s Story died,main to rumours of curseFour hundred years after it was written, a lost and supposedly cursed Golden Age novel chronicling the splendour, and adventure and violence of Spain’s imperial zenith (the point of culmination; peak) has been published for the first time.
Historia del Huérfano,or The Orphan’s Story, charts the progress of a 14-year-old Spaniard who leaves Granada and heads to the Americas to seek his fortune. Its hero ricochets around the Spanish empire, or from the tall-society fiestas of Lima to the mephitic mines of Potosí,and goes on to witness Sir Francis Drake’s attack on Puerto Rico and the sacking of Cádiz.
